According to a post resonating on Hacker News, there's an asymmetry worth noticing: if you want someone's attention, show them you've put in effort. It's not just politeness—it's about respect. Whether you're filing a bug report, asking for code review, or requesting feedback, demonstrating you've done your homework makes a difference. The piece explores how this principle extends to communication norms across technical communities.
